You don't need that big of an anchor. A 12' skiff isn't the most stable platform and trying to pull a 35# anchor is asking for trouble. Get a light Danforth and some chain the length of your boat. 3/8" 3 strand should be sufficient to hold your boat. There are days when you won't have enough scope on your anchor line. 150' of line will fit in a bucket and let you anchor in up to 75' or so of water with a 2 to 1 scope.

dont over think it... a standard deep cycle group 24 is more than adequate and light enough for a 12' skiff. bump up to a group 27 or larger if you plan on being out for a long day. I've never needed a boat charging system for my battery. I charge it up at the end of the day in the garage and its good to go next time. don't waste your time with a battery box.. you'll find you'll never put the lid on it cause it knocks the alligator clips off the terminals. I also have a small bilge pump set up on alligator clips that I can hook up in a hurry if I need to.
for an anchor on my 14' skiff, when I'm in salt water, I use a 5 lb danforth with 3' of galvanized lightweight chain and 30' of 5/16 rope... I have a small bow on my boat so I put a roller and cleat to make it easy to raise and drop... (in the salt, i'm never anchoring in more than 10-12' of water)
in fresh water, a milk jug full of rocks and 30' of rope is more than adequate
